Transaction 1753877951750394bb4adb5ff00b0efe90f691c0cea8d7937e2dd09f2e6fbd36
1 Input
1 Output
-
1753877951750394bb4adb5ff00b0efe90f691c0cea8d7937e2dd09f2e6fbd36:0
- value
- 2908584
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 67f1d6e68671466376e78ebde7d361e37469950d OP_EQUAL
- address
- 3BAdEbt4yorppfoiG1kSWyD5NUiUi8BwUr